Halloween cupcakes

These are easy enough for the shortest attention spans!  I got this recipe from my MIL & it is very simple and tasty....only 2 ingredients (well, I guess 3 if you count the chocolate candy pieces :)  I love to bake with Jessie, but I often find that she only has a very limited attention span for measuring, etc.  That's why this recipe is so simple.

Pumpkin-Cake Mix Muffins (Cupcakes):
1 can 15 oz purree pumpkin
1 box cake mix (your choice)
chocolate chips, cinnamon chips, butterscotch chips, candy, etc.

Preheat oven 350 degrees. Mix pumpkin & cake mix together until well combined (Jessie loves to mix for me).  Then add in chips, if using.  Place in muffin tin & bake for 15-20 min. depending on your oven.  Mine usually bakes for around 18 min.  Cool, then frost & decorate as desired!

This is all you need...I added the Reese's pieces to be festive for Halloween & the pumpkin cupcake liners were a must!
When I first heard about these from my MIL she called them weight watchers muffins, so they really aren't that bad for you either, which is also nice (although after I added the candy & the butter cream, that may not be true :).  Enjoy a few pics of our Halloween cupcake experiment & have a wonderful day!
